Gusto
enterpriseGusto automates payroll processing, tax filings, benefits administration, and HR compliance for small to medium-sized businesses.
Guaranteed payroll accuracy with next-day direct deposit and full multi-state tax handling included
Gusto is an all-in-one payroll, HR, and benefits platform tailored for small to medium-sized businesses, automating payroll processing, tax calculations, filings, and payments across all 50 states. It simplifies employee onboarding, time tracking, and compliance with features like automated W-2s, 1099s, and ACA reporting. Beyond payroll, Gusto integrates benefits administration, performance management, and employee self-service tools to streamline HR workflows.
Pros
- Full-service payroll with automatic tax filing and compliance guarantees
- Intuitive interface with mobile app for employees and admins
- Seamless integrations with 100+ tools like QuickBooks and Slack
Cons
- Pricing scales quickly with add-ons and contractors
- Advanced HR features may require higher-tier plans
- Customer support can have longer wait times during peak seasons
Best For
Small to medium-sized businesses seeking an intuitive, compliant payroll solution with integrated HR and benefits management.
Pricing
Simple ($40 base + $6/person/mo), Plus ($80 + $12/person/mo), Premium (custom quote); contractors $35/mo + $6 each.
Rippling
enterpriseRippling unifies payroll, HR, IT, and finance into a single platform with global payroll capabilities.
Real-time Policy Sync that automatically propagates employee changes (e.g., salary updates) across payroll, benefits, IT provisioning, and finance in seconds
Rippling is a comprehensive workforce management platform that unifies payroll, HR, IT, and finance into a single system, automating payroll processing, tax filings, and compliance across 100+ countries. It enables real-time synchronization of employee data, ensuring instant updates to payroll from changes in benefits, devices, or onboarding. Ideal for scaling businesses, it reduces manual errors and administrative time through AI-driven automation and customizable workflows.
Pros
- Seamless integration of payroll with HR, IT, and finance for real-time data sync
- Global payroll support in 100+ countries with automated compliance and multi-currency payments
- Advanced automation for onboarding/offboarding, deductions, and custom reporting
Cons
- Higher cost structure better suited for mid-to-large teams than solopreneurs
- Steep initial learning curve due to extensive feature set
- Custom implementation may require setup time and support
Best For
Mid-sized to enterprise companies seeking an all-in-one platform for global payroll integrated with full workforce management.
Pricing
Custom pricing starts at $8 per active user/month for core HR/payroll; scales with add-ons like global payroll ($10-20/user/month) and requires annual contracts.

Justworks
enterpriseJustworks acts as a PEO to handle payroll, benefits, and compliance for small businesses.
Co-employment PEO model enabling small businesses to offer premium group health benefits at competitive rates
Justworks is a Professional Employer Organization (PEO) platform that offers comprehensive payroll processing alongside HR, benefits administration, and compliance services for small to medium-sized businesses. It automates payroll runs, tax calculations, withholdings, and filings across multiple states, with support for both employees and contractors. The service leverages a co-employment model to provide access to larger-group benefits rates, making it a full-service solution beyond standalone payroll software.
Pros
- Automated multi-state payroll and tax compliance
- Integrated HR and benefits management
- Strong customer support with dedicated account managers
Cons
- Higher costs due to PEO co-employment model
- Less ideal for very large enterprises or highly customized needs
- Limited standalone payroll options without full PEO commitment
Best For
Small to medium-sized businesses needing an all-in-one outsourced payroll, HR, and benefits solution.
Pricing
Starts at $59 per active employee per month plus a base monthly fee (typically $99+), with custom quotes based on business size and needs.
